Overview

In its 2024 IRS Form 990-PF filing, Lightner Sams Foundation of Wyoming reported 51 grants totaling $397,000 to 51 organizations across 12 states and territories, most often for general operating support. Its largest reported grant was $53,000 to Lander Community Foundation.
